Jiahui Li is a scholar working on Global and Planetary Change,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is and Pollution. According to data from OpenAlex, Jiahui Li has authored 73 papers receiving a total of 911 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 13 papers in Global and Planetary Change, 10 papers in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is and 9 papers in Pollution. Recurrent topics in Jiahui Li's work include Microplastics and Plastic Pollution (8 papers), Recycling and Waste Management Techniques (8 papers) and Land Use and Ecosystem Services (7 papers). Jiahui Li is often cited by papers focused on Microplastics and Plastic Pollution (8 papers), Recycling and Waste Management Techniques (8 papers) and Land Use and Ecosystem Services (7 papers). Jiahui Li coll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Czechia. Jiahui Li's co-authors include Hanzhong Jia, Ze Liu, Jianqun Wang, Zhongmin Li, Qingyong Li, Linye Zhang, Guangtao Wei, Zhong Liu, Hanqing Wu and Jianing Xu and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ature Communications, Environmental Science & Technology and The Science of The Total Environment.
